Cornhole Champion Quadruple Amputee Arrested for Murder

In a shocking turn of events, Dayton James Webber, a quadruple amputee known for his remarkable achievements in the American Cornhole League, finds himself facing first- and second-degree murder charges in connection with the tragic death of Bradrick Michael Wells in La Plata, Maryland. Background: A Star Emerges Amidst Adversity
Webber, 27, was diagnosed with Streptococcus pneumoniae as an infant, a bacterial infection that necessitated the amputation of all four limbs to save his life. This harrowing experience did not deter him but instead fueled an extraordinary journey where he became the first quadruple amputee to compete in the American Cornhole League, even earning accolades as the best player in Maryland in 2020. His story, broadcasted in the ESPN special “The World Won’t Wait,” resonated deeply, inspiring many.
The Incident: From an Argument to Arrest
The events leading to Webber’s arrest unfolded on a grim Sunday night. Witnesses reported that during a dispute, Webber allegedly shot Wells while they were in a vehicle on La Plata Road. The aftershock of this violent act was palpable as witnesses, terrified, fled the scene, leaving Webber with Wells’ body in the car. Almost two hours later, Wells was discovered deceased in a nearby yard, leading to a swift investigation by the Charles County Sheriff’s Office. Webber was apprehended in Charlottesville, Virginia, where he had sought medical treatment, further complicating the narrative surrounding his psychological and physical state.
